1. What is a Matco OBD2 Scanner and How Does It Work?
A Matco OBD2 scanner is a professional-grade diagnostic tool used by automotive technicians to diagnose and troubleshoot vehicle issues. It works by accessing the vehicle’s onboard computer system, reading diagnostic trouble codes (DTCs), and providing real-time data about various vehicle systems. According to a study by the University of California, Berkeley, in 2022, OBD2 scanners can accurately identify the source of engine problems in 85% of cases, thereby improving diagnostic accuracy.
- Accessing the Vehicle’s Computer: The scanner connects to the vehicle’s OBD2 port, typically located under the dashboard.
- Reading Diagnostic Trouble Codes (DTCs): The scanner retrieves DTCs, which are codes that indicate specific problems within the vehicle’s systems.
- Providing Real-Time Data: The scanner displays real-time data, such as engine speed, temperature, and sensor readings, which helps technicians diagnose issues accurately.

5. What Do the Different OBD2 Codes Mean?
OBD2 codes are standardized codes that indicate specific problems within a vehicle’s systems. Each code consists of five characters: a letter followed by four numbers and can be looked up on OBD2-SCANNER.EDU.VN. The letter indicates the system (P for powertrain, B for body, C for chassis, and U for network), and the numbers specify the exact fault. According to the Society of Automotive Engineers (SAE), understanding these codes is crucial for accurate vehicle diagnostics and repair.
Common OBD2 Code Categories:
- P0xxx: Powertrain – Generic
- P1xxx: Powertrain – Manufacturer Specific
- B0xxx: Body – Generic
- B1xxx: Body – Manufacturer Specific
- C0xxx: Chassis – Generic
- C1xxx: Chassis – Manufacturer Specific
- U0xxx: Network – Generic
- U1xxx: Network – Manufacturer Specific

7. What is the Difference Between a Matco OBD2 Scanner and a Basic Code Reader?
The difference between a Matco OBD2 scanner and a basic code reader lies in their capabilities. Matco scanners offer advanced diagnostics, real-time data, and bi-directional testing, while basic code readers typically only read and clear DTCs. A report by Consumer Reports in 2023 notes that advanced scanners provide more comprehensive information, leading to more accurate diagnoses.
Comparison Table:
Feature | Matco OBD2 Scanner | Basic Code Reader |
---|---|---|
Diagnostics | Advanced, OE-level | Basic, DTC reading only |
Real-Time Data | Yes | Limited or No |
Bi-Directional Test | Yes | No |
Vehicle Coverage | Extensive, Asian, European, Domestic | Limited |
Additional Features | Remote diagnostics, TSB access | None |

11. Understanding the Technical Specifications of the MAXIMUS 3.0
The MAXIMUS 3.0 boasts impressive technical specifications designed to enhance diagnostic capabilities. Its 8 Core Cortex-A53 2.0GHZ CPU ensures rapid processing, while the 10.1″ 1920×1200 display offers clear visuals. Key specs include a front 8mp/Rear 13mp camera, 4GB of memory, and 64GB of storage. It operates efficiently between 14ºF and 122ºF, powered by a 9360mAh battery with Quick Charge 3.0.
Detailed Specifications:
- CPU: 8 Core Cortex-A53 2.0GHZ
- Display: 10.1″ 1920×1200
- Camera: Front 8mp/Rear 13mp+AF+Flash
- Memory: 4G
- Storage: 64GB
- Operating Temperature: 14ºF – 122ºF
- Storage Temperature: -4ºF – 158ºF
- Battery: 9360mAh with Quick Charge 3.0
- Ingress Protection: IP65 Rating
- Dimensions: 12.95″ x 8.74″ x 1.75″

26. How to Interpret Freeze Frame Data on a Matco OBD2 Scanner
Freeze frame data on a Matco OBD2 scanner captures the engine’s operating conditions at the moment a fault code was triggered. Interpreting this data helps technicians understand the context of the problem. Automotive Engineering International reports that analyzing freeze frame data can significantly reduce diagnostic time.
Interpreting Freeze Frame Data:
- Operating Conditions: Understand the conditions when the fault occurred.
- Contextual Understanding: Provides context for the problem.
- Efficient Diagnostics: Reduces diagnostic time.

29. Understanding Bi-Directional Controls on the Matco OBD2 Scanner
Bi-directional controls on Matco OBD2 scanners allow technicians to send commands to vehicle systems, testing components and verifying functionality. This capability is essential for comprehensive diagnostics. The American Automotive Technicians Association (AATA) highlights that bi-directional controls can significantly reduce diagnostic time.
Benefits of Bi-Directional Controls:
- System Commands: Sends commands to vehicle systems.
- Component Testing: Tests components for functionality.
- Diagnostic Verification: Verifies diagnostic results.
